Conferences

Morbidity and Mortality Conference

The Department of Surgery holds a weekly M&M conference on Thursday mornings at 7:00 am. The fellows and residents on the vascular rotation are expected to post and present vascular morbidities and mortalities for discussion.

M & M takes place in the Gross Conference Room at 7 am every Thursday followed by Grand Rounds. Most of the Grand Rounds lectures are recorded and available online

Educational Conference

Weekly Vascular Surgery education conferences are held on Friday mornings at 7:00 am. Twice a month the vascular fellows share the responsibility of presenting a topic followed by a discussion with the faculty.

The remaining two Fridays of the month are dedicated to a combined conference with the Pennsylvania Hospital Vascular Fellowship Program. This combined conference is arranged so that, in alternating fashion, the fellows from one program present cases while the fellows from the other program are quizzed in oral board style. 

Journal Club

Journal club is held once every three months. Three articles or clinical guidelines are selected based on a specific topic. The fellows present the purpose and methods of the study followed by a review of the results and a critique of the study.Vascular Surgery faculty members serve as moderators.

The Division of Vascular and Endovascular Surgery is also the Host for the Online Journal of Vascular Surgery Journal Club a virtual platform within which important articles in the literature are presented, reviewed and discussed by experts in the field as well as the contributing authors.
